Finance Review — Lumawheel Loyalty Overhaul

Short version: the old points model was costing us more than it earned. The revamped Lumawheel tiers cut redemption liability by roughly a third while early pilots in Castermouth show repeat purchases up nicely. Margins on tier upgrades look healthy, though breakage assumptions still need a second pass from Jonas. Budget for the relaunch is approved through year-end. The confidential plan summary sits just below.

board note of kajeg-taduf: The pricing group signed off on a budget of $23.8 million for Project Istys. The renewal with Norwynix Group closes at $56.9 million a year, 52 percent above the last contract.

Onboarding: Quillgate Audit-Log Viewer

Support reads logs via Quillgate only. No direct database access. Search by tenant, actor, or event type. Exports are capped at 10k rows; escalate larger pulls to the Marrow Lane data team. Retention is 90 days. Sessions time out after 15 minutes idle. If Quillgate locks you out mid-shift and the duty lead is unreachable, unseal the standby console with the phrase that follows below.

unlock words, yagaf-hahog: casvan-fraath-praath-novwyn-prair-eliath

Runbook: GarageGlance occupancy feed

If the Harborview Deck occupancy feed goes stale (no updates for 5+ minutes), first check the sensor gateway health page. Green but stale usually means the aggregator queue is backed up; restart the aggregator via the ops console and counts should recover within two minutes. If spots show negative numbers, force a full recount from the camera snapshots. When escalating to engineering, include the trace token shown below.

session token of yawif-kahof = htk9_dd6996ed6